Sears Pulls Controversial Ashli Babbitt 'Patriot' T-Shirt The Hoffman Estates-based company was selling shirts calling the woman shot dead during the Jan. 6 attack on the U.S. Capitol a "patriot." Indoor Mini-Golf Course Planned At Former Chuck E. Cheese The 8,400-square-foot building on W Dundee Road has been vacant since 2015 in Arlington Heights. Update: Boy Missing From Palatine Township Safely Located The 12-year-old had last been seen at his residence around 2:30 p.m. Tuesday. Alternative Fuel Corridor Signs Going Up on Interstate 55 The Federal Highway Administration has designated 145,000 miles of interstate for promoting alternative fuels. Opposite-Sex Clothing Ban Repealed In Elk Grove Village The 1961 local ordinance banned people from wearing "clothes properly belonging to the opposite sex."
